Gwibber is an open-source microblogging client for the GNOME desktop environment. It enables users to access social networking sites like Facebook, Twitter, etc. from their desktop.

Tailwind CSS is an open-source CSS framework that focuses on utility-first classes to enable rapid UI development. It allows developers to build custom user interfaces without writing custom CSS by providing pre-defined classes for typography, spacing, color, layout, and more.
